Team: Juliette Collier, National Director

Expand

Juliette is one of our National Directors at the Campaign. As well as co-directing the Campaign with Julia, she leads on our family and community learning activities and parental engagement work in schools.

Juliette is a powerful and passionate advocate for the use of family learning approaches in developing motivation and confidence for learning for people of all ages, and for the importance of family learning in developing different and complimentary skills and knowledge to formal education. Juliette co-ordinates our large scale research projects which aim to show the impact of family learning and parental engagement on a range of outcomes for both children and adults.

Team: Julia Wright, National Director

Expand

Julia is one of our National Directors. As well as co-directing the Campaign with Juliette, she leads on our policy activities and our work with employers and workplaces. Julia co-ordinates the Campaign's policy seminar and events programme and is responsible for commissioning and publishing our policy reports. Julia is passionate about using creative and collaborative approaches to building learning cultures at work and engaging people in learning. She leads on the Campaign's Learning at Work Week.

Team: Tricia Hartley, Lead Consultant

Expand

Tricia is one of the Campaign's lead consultants. Tricia was CEO of the Campaign until January 2015. Since she retired from this full time role, she chairs our policy seminar programme, which brings together learning sector professionals to discuss government policy with civil servants and sector leaders.
